Infant Fatally Shot When Man Tried To Stand Up

Authorities have arrested a central New York man who claims a loaded shotgun he was holding discharged accidentally when he tried to stand up, striking and killing a 7-month-old boy.

Rome police say 18-year-old Henry Bartle faces a charge of criminally negligent homicide. He was arrested early Sunday.

Authorities say Bartle was in his apartment on Saturday with his girlfriend, who's the baby's mother, and another man, and was cleaning the 12-gauge shotgun in the living room. Police say he then loaded the gun and had it in his lap pointing in the direction of the child.

The baby was struck in the upper body when the gun went off.

It was unclear if Bartle has an attorney.
